The University of Virginia or commonly known as UVA, was founded in 1819 by Thomas Jefferson who was the third President of the United States. UVA is a public university, whose main campus is located in Charlottesville which is in Central Virginia. The University of Virginia campus is spread across 1,682 acres of land. The University of Virginia houses its Medical Center which has 671 beds and has been ranked #1 Hospital in Virginia by Newsweek in the year 2022.
University of Virginia rankings as per US News & World Report – Best Colleges 2023 stands at #3 among other public universities in the USA. In terms of national level rankings, UVA ranks at #25 for the year 2023 as per US News & World Report - National University Ranking. While UVA ranks at #156 as per THE (Times Higher Education) - University Ranking for 2023. The University of Virginia QS ranking for World Universities was recorded at #260 for the year 2024.
In terms of academics, Virgnia University vary in number based on levels. At the undergraduate level, there are around 76 courses with four minors, at the graduate level UVA offers 69 Master’s and 55 doctoral courses are offered along with eight certificate courses. UVA courses are offered in 11 schools and one college of – Arts & Sciences, Data Science, Business, Education & Human Development, Business, Leadership & Public Policy, Engineering & Applied Science, Commerce, Law, Medicine, Architecture and Nursing.
For the class of 2026, University of Virginia acceptance rate was reported at 19%. Hence, University of Virginia admissions were moderately selective for the year 2021. Around 12% of the admitted students at UVA were first generation students and 9% of the students were international.
The University of Virginia offers on-campus housing for its enrolled students. First year students can choose from designated traditional residential halls like - Alderman Road and McCormick Road are hall-style housing and, Alderman Road is a suite-style housing option. There are also three residential colleges which can also be opted by students of all years at UVA. Though students can submit their preferences, but they will be allotted only those options which are deemed suitable by the UVA housing committee.
At the University of Virginia students are offered on-campus placements. In 2021, the University of Virginia placement rate was reported at 76.2% and the average annual salary was reported at USD 70,604. UVA has been recognized by PayScale for offering a good return on investment, since students don’t bag an employment offer below USD 62,000 on an average.
UVA has a total of 230,000 alumni who are alive and reside in various parts of the world. Some of notable alumni of University of Virginia are – Edgar Allan Poe an American Romantic writer, Robert F. Kennedy who was a US Senator, Sarah Drew a notable American actress, Francis Sellers Collins who was a physician-geneticist and led the project on Human Genome Project, and many others.

International students need to submit academic transcripts, English proficiency test score (IELTS or TOEFL), SOP, LOR, Admission essay, and proof of finances as necessary admission requirements while applying to the University of Virginia.
- Application fees :USD 250

- The residence option includes rooms(private or shared), studio apartment, 4 bedroom apartment, 3 bedroom apartment, 2 bedroom apartment and 1 bedroom apartment
- The average room rent for the Shared Room is $610/month and for Private Room in $808/month
- Many Properties includes the bill of WiFi in Room, WiFi in Communal Areas and Cable or Satellite TV Subscription in rent
- Facilities include High-Speed Internet Access, Fitness Center, Air Conditioning, Kitchen, Oven, Laundry etc.
